回答:用中文編程理論是可行的計(jì)算機(jī)是以二進(jìn)制來運(yùn)算和處理數(shù)據(jù)的,對于計(jì)算機(jī)來說,它只認(rèn)識0和1。所以指令和數(shù)據(jù)都需要轉(zhuǎn)換為0和1的組合才能被計(jì)算機(jī)識別。但我們不可能用用0和1來編程啊,這樣的效率是極奇低的,也難以識別出錯誤。于是聰明絕頂?shù)娜祟惏l(fā)明了匯編語言,也可以叫做符號語言,用助記符代替計(jì)算機(jī)指令的操作碼,用地址符號或標(biāo)號代替指令或者操作數(shù)的地址。比如ADD 代表加,JMP代表跳轉(zhuǎn);因?yàn)榘l(fā)明匯編語言的...
回答:Java中的HashMap可以說是平時(shí)開發(fā)中最常用的數(shù)據(jù)結(jié)構(gòu)之一了,經(jīng)常使用的集合類還有ArrayList、HashSet,基本上用好HashMap、ArrayList、HashSet這三大集合類,大多數(shù)的業(yè)務(wù)場景就滿足了,掌握這三大集合類也是作為一名Java程序員的基礎(chǔ)能力。平時(shí)開發(fā)大多數(shù)的業(yè)務(wù)場景都是CRUD,且數(shù)據(jù)量都很小,所以基本上不會有什么問題。那么還需要知道其底層實(shí)現(xiàn)原理嗎?還需要知道...
...中類可分為以下三種: 普通類:使用 class 定義且不含有抽象方法的類。 抽象類:使用 abstract class 定義的類,它可以含有或不含有抽象方法。 接口:使用 interface 定義的類。 上述三種類存在以下的繼承規(guī)律: 普通類可以繼承...
...,把對象地址賦值給s變量 類 基本包括:繼承、多態(tài)、抽象類、接口、包和導(dǎo)包、權(quán)限修飾符、內(nèi)部類 類的繼承 概述:多個(gè)類中存在相同屬性和行為時(shí),將這些內(nèi)容抽取到單獨(dú)一個(gè)類中,那么多個(gè)類無需再定義這些屬性和行...
...類型。 支持更改實(shí)施; 防止依賴于實(shí)施細(xì)節(jié) 問題:打破抽象邊界 客戶必須知道具體表示類的名稱。 因?yàn)镴ava中的接口不能包含構(gòu)造函數(shù),所以它們必須直接調(diào)用其中一個(gè)具體類的構(gòu)造函數(shù)。 構(gòu)造函數(shù)的規(guī)范不會出現(xiàn)在接口的...
...實(shí)現(xiàn)接口的格式? 說出接口中成員的特點(diǎn)? 接口和抽象類的區(qū)別? 能夠說出使用多態(tài)的前提條件? 理解多態(tài)的向上轉(zhuǎn)型? 理解多態(tài)的向下轉(zhuǎn)型? 能夠完成筆記本電腦案例(方法參數(shù)為接口) 第1章 接口 1.1 ...
...有共性還有自身特有的內(nèi)容 *c:整個(gè)繼承體系,越向上越抽象,越向下越具體 06繼承后子類父類成員變量的特點(diǎn) A:繼承后子類父類成員變量的特點(diǎn) a:子類的對象調(diào)用成員變量的時(shí)候,子類自己有,使用子類,子類自己沒有調(diào)用的父...
...什么是繼承 就是把多個(gè)具有具有相同的屬性和行為的類抽象到一個(gè)類,然后遇到相似的行為和屬性,就可以直接繼承,沒有重復(fù)寫。 優(yōu)點(diǎn) 復(fù)用性強(qiáng) 類與類之間有關(guān)系,是多態(tài)的前提 繼承的特點(diǎn) 1, Java只支持單繼承 //一...
...,這個(gè)過程稱為內(nèi)聯(lián)。(挖個(gè)坑,以后學(xué)到JVM時(shí)來填) 抽象方法必須在抽象類中 抽象類除了抽象方法,還可以包含具體數(shù)據(jù)和具體方法。例如Person類可以保存姓名和一個(gè)返回姓名的具體方法 public abstract class Person { private Stri...
...護(hù)性好。 由于對于已有的軟件系統(tǒng)的組件,特別是它的抽象底層不去修改,因此,我們不用擔(dān)心軟件系統(tǒng)中原有組件的穩(wěn)定性,這就使變化中的軟件系統(tǒng)有一定的穩(wěn)定性和延續(xù)性。如:一人模塊變化,會對其它的模塊產(chǎn)生影響...
...) { } else { } } } 抽象類 使用abstract修飾的類成為抽象類 1. 某一個(gè)父類只知道子類應(yīng)該含有怎樣的方法,但是無法確定這個(gè)子類的方法如何實(shí)現(xiàn) 2. 從多個(gè)具有相同特征的類中抽象出一個(gè)抽...
...能派生子類。 Abstract 和 interface兩個(gè)關(guān)鍵字分別用于定義抽象類和接口,抽象類和接口都是從多個(gè)子類中抽象出來的共同特征,但抽象類主要作為多個(gè)類的模板,而接口則定義了多類應(yīng)該遵守的規(guī)則。 基本數(shù)據(jù)類型 包裝類 b...
... 接口是功能的集合,同樣可看做是一種數(shù)據(jù)類型,是比抽象類更為抽象的類。 接口只描述所應(yīng)該具備的方法,并沒有具體實(shí)現(xiàn),具體的實(shí)現(xiàn)由接口的實(shí)現(xiàn)類(相當(dāng)于接口的子類)來完成。這樣將功能的定義與實(shí)現(xiàn)分離,...
...返回?cái)?shù)組 * concat,追加字符串 對比 * equals * compareTo 抽象類必須要有抽象方法嗎 抽象類中可以不含有抽象方法,日常開發(fā)主要使用抽象類作為模板,若抽象類不含抽象方法,我覺得喪失了抽象類原有的功能 普通類和抽象類...
... ADT是通過創(chuàng)建以操作為特征的類型而不是其表示的數(shù)據(jù)抽象。對于抽象數(shù)據(jù)類型,抽象函數(shù)(AF)解釋了如何將具體表示值解釋為抽象類型的值,并且我們看到了抽象函數(shù)的選擇如何決定如何編寫實(shí)現(xiàn)每個(gè)ADT操作的代碼。抽象函...
...獨(dú)一無二的 類 創(chuàng)建對象的藍(lán)圖和模板 類的屬性:數(shù)據(jù)抽象 類的方法:行為抽象 構(gòu)造器(構(gòu)造方法) 接口 抽象方法的集合 作用: 能力,實(shí)現(xiàn)一個(gè)接口就代表具備了某方面的能力 約定,一個(gè)類實(shí)現(xiàn)了接口就必須實(shí)現(xiàn)接口中...
ChatGPT和Sora等AI大模型應(yīng)用,將AI大模型和算力需求的熱度不斷帶上新的臺階。哪里可以獲得...
大模型的訓(xùn)練用4090是不合適的,但推理(inference/serving)用4090不能說合適,...
圖示為GPU性能排行榜,我們可以看到所有GPU的原始相關(guān)性能圖表。同時(shí)根據(jù)訓(xùn)練、推理能力由高到低做了...